The finale of Miss Universe contest took place on May 16 at Florida. Making India proud, Adline Castelino bagged the fourth position in the contest. The 22-year-old, who traces her roots to Udupi in Karnataka, had won Miss Diva 2020 making her India’s representative at Miss Universe, this year.

It was Adline’s final statement during the contest which got her all the appreciation. She was asked to talk about ‘free speech and the right to protest.’ She said, “The right to protest. We’ve seen many protests in recent days. Especially I want to point out the protests that women have made throughout the years with equal rights. Until today, we lacked them. Because protest helps us raise our voice against what’s happening against inequality. It helps minorities in any democracy to raise their voice. So, the protest is very important. But what’s not important is when you use it, because with every right comes responsibility for the use of it with power.”
